Abstract

1337069 Shielded enclosures GESELLSCHAFT FLIER KERNFORSCHUNG mbH 23 Dec 1971 [29 Dec 1970] 60102/71 Heading B4Q The screening wall 1 of a hot cell 2 has an opening 3 through which a manipulator 5 extends, a cover 6 of the manipulator being secured to a tube 7 which is in turn secured in a flange 9 by bolts 10. In front of the cover 6 there is a bellows 14 made of a transparent material and including a pocket 16 containing a "double cover" system 17 comprising two parts 18, 19 interconnected by a screw coupling 20. At its end facing the cover 6, the bellows 14 has a cover 21 secured to a flange 22 by bolts 23. In order to remove the manipulator 5, the covers 6, 21 are coupled by means of screws 24 and the bolts 10, 23 are then released. Thereafter the length of the bellows 14 is increased (by hand or mechanically) and the "double cover" system formed by the covers 6, 21 completely withdrawn into the interior of the bellows together with the manipulator 5. Subsequently, the "double cover" system 17 in the pocket 16 is moved by hand to the opening 3 and inserted such that one part 18 fits into the flange 9 and the other part 19 fits into the flange 22, the parts being secured by the bolts 10, 23. The screw coupling 20 between the parts 18, 19 is then released and the two flanges 9, 22 are separated. Devices may be located within the bellows 14 which are actuated from the outside, by means of which the "double cover" system 17 or the manipulator 5 can be moved. It is possible to replace the bellows 14 by a telescopically extensible tube. When using a metal tube (e.g. on account of the gamma rays emanating from the opening 3), protected openings with lead glass windows may be provided for observation purposes.
